First, users select eligible collateral from a broad spectrum—stablecoins like USDT or USDC for a straightforward 1:1 minting ratio, or non-stablecoins such as BTC, ETH, or even tokenized RWAs like U.S. Treasuries and gold, which require a dynamic overcollateralization ratio (OCR) greater than 1 to account for volatility, calculated as the initial collateral value divided by the USDf amount minted. This step evokes a sense of careful stewardship, as the protocol evaluates liquidity and risk to set appropriate buffers, ensuring your assets are protected. Next, upon deposit, USDf is minted instantly, providing immediate on-chain liquidity that you can use for trading, lending, or payments without liquidating your holdings—imagine the relief of accessing dollars while your BTC continues to appreciate in the background. For non-stable collateral, an overcollateralization buffer is held, redeemable based on market price comparisons to the initial mark: if the current price is higher or equal, you reclaim based on value; if lower, based on units, adding a layer of fairness that resonates with the human need for equity. Finally, redemption completes the cycle: burn USDf to retrieve collateral after a seven-day cooldown for safe unwinding, or leverage peg arbitrage opportunities when USDf deviates from $1, buying low and redeeming high, turning market inefficiencies into personal gains that feel like clever triumphs over systemic chaos.

Begin by staking your minted USDf into the protocol's vaults, where it's converted to sUSDf at a ratio that reflects accumulated rewards: sUSDf minted equals USDf staked divided by the current sUSDf-to-USDf value, incorporating total staked USDf plus rewards over total sUSDf supply. This initial step sparks joy, as sUSDf begins accruing yields from diversified sources, distributed proportionally—your share is your staked USDf over total staked, multiplied by total yield, evoking the communal warmth of shared prosperity. To amplify this, opt for boosted staking by locking sUSDf for fixed terms like 3-6 months, receiving an ERC-721 NFT as a token of commitment, which unlocks higher APYs and multipliers, turning time into a powerful ally against inflation and stagnation. Initially, collateral screening tests for liquidity and volatility, setting dynamic OCR buffers to absorb shocks, while delta-neutral hedging maintains near-zero net exposure through perpetual and spot market balancing. Automated systems monitor positions in real-time, with manual oversight for volatility unwinds, and custody employs MPC, multi-sig, and hardware keys to minimize exchange risks. The seven-day redemption cooldown adds a thoughtful pause, allowing safe strategy exits, while a $10M on-chain insurance fund acts as a compassionate backstop, absorbing losses and supporting the peg during crises. Transparency shines through weekly reserve attestations, real-time dashboards showing TVL and APY, and quarterly audits like ISAE3000 reports, fostering trust that heals the wounds of opaque protocols and empowers users with knowledge.

Start with funding rate arbitrage: positive for stablecoins in high-demand environments, negative for altcoins by longing perpetuals and shorting spots during low rates, capturing spreads that feel like hidden treasures unearthed from market inefficiencies. Cross-exchange price arbitrage follows, exploiting discrepancies between CEXs and DEXs, while native staking on altcoins adds organic yields. Options and statistical arbitrage diversify further, with a balanced 50/50 portfolio between altcoins and stablecoins outperforming single strategies, as historical data shows aggregated yields thriving in varied conditions. With a fixed 10 billion supply and 23.4% initial circulation, allocations prioritize ecosystem growth (35%), foundation (24%), and vested teams/investors, ensuring long-term alignment without early dumps until late 2026. Staking $FF reduces fees, boosts yields, and grants governance votes on parameters, while programs like Falcon Miles reward engagement with multipliers up to 72x for liquidity provision and referrals, fostering a sense of belonging and shared success.
